Relating to processes in the body that happen automatically and without conscious control, such as heart rate and digestion.
The autonomic nervous system regulates functions like breathing and heartbeat without us having to think about it.
Autonomic → It is formed from "auto-" (from Greek "αὐτός", meaning self) and "nomos" (from Greek, meaning law or regulation). The word "autonomic" refers to self-regulating systems, particularly in biology, where it describes processes that occur without conscious control.
